Poste Moderne Brasserie will officially re-open its popular courtyard, “The Garden,” with an Earth Day celebration benefiting FreshFarm Markets.
Guests are invited to enjoy small bites, refreshing cocktails, and wine while supporting FreshFarm Markets, an organization that showcases our region’s farmers and their agricultural bounty.
Highlights from the Earth Day Garden Party include:
· Guests can enjoy samples of truffle frites and warm gougères from Chef Robert Weland’s new small plates menu, available only in The Garden at Poste.
· Mixologist Rico Wisner will stir up his new menu of punches, available exclusively in The Garden at Poste.
· The Garden at Poste will also premiere its new, all-Virginia wine list in support of regional winemakers. Representatives from local wineries will be on hand to provide tastings of their wines. Participating wineries include Kluge Estates, Pollak Vineyards, and Thibaut-Jannison Winery. Wine importer, Danny Hass will pour biodynamic and organic wines, which will be featured on the new list.
· Jocelyn Cambier from J. Cambier Imports will provide samples of French microbrewery beers.
· Cheese samples will be provided by neighboring Cowgirl Creamery, a Penn Quarter favorite that has been producing organic cheese for the past 12 years in Point Reyes Station, California and promotes artisan cheesemakers from both the U.S. and Europe.
To accommodate the ever-growing popularity of the outdoor venue, The Garden at Poste is also excited to introduce a new outdoor bar, wood-burning grill, and hand-held computers. All of these added improvements will ensure even more attentive service to guests.
For the patio season, The Garden at Poste will offer its new menu starting at 5 pm, daily. New additions include sheep’s milk ricotta stuffed squash blossoms with garden arugula pesto ($14); artichoke fritters with green goddess sauce ($14) and cousin George’s party mix ($7).
